Commercial Pipe Repair Questions
What types of pipes can be repaired commercially? Commercial pipe repair services address a variety of pipes including water supply lines, drain and sewer pipes, and gas lines to ensure proper function across different systems.
When is pipe repair necessary in a commercial property? Repairs are needed when leaks, corrosion, blockages, or pipe damage cause water or gas issues, or when pipes are aging and at risk of failure.
What are common signs that a commercial pipe needs repair? Signs include persistent leaks, low water pressure, unusual noises, or foul odors indicating pipe issues that require attention.
What types of projects are typically handled with commercial pipe repair? Projects often involve fixing leaking pipes, replacing damaged sections, clearing blockages, and upgrading aging piping systems to prevent future problems.
